Debt And Loans


Getting Out Of Debt And Toward A Better Future

This part of the site is all about debt and how to get rid of it. We all get into trouble with debt at some time in our life, then begins the long journey out of it. Things might seem bleak at the moment but if you follow some good advice and stick with it you can get free of your debt.

Loans

Loans are one of the primary ways people get into debt in the first place.  Knowing what to look out for when choosing one can be key to keeping yourself out of trouble later on.
